Places to visit in the surrounding area include Tate's Hell Nature Trail, the Historic Carrabelle Lighthouse and Museum, Camp Gordon Johnston World War II Museum, Panacea's Gulf Specimen Marine Lab (with touch pools for children) and the Apalachicola National Estuarine Research Reserve. Various activities are available, including Dog Island Ferry excursions, charter fishing, kayaking, birding, cycling paths across the road, and guided boat tours at Wakulla Springs. There are a variety of local seafood eateries and a local supermarket. Also close by is the beautiful St. James Bay Golf Course, designed by Robert Walker. The St. Marks Wildlife Refuge is an excellent outing for the entire family. Located a little over an hour from Tallahassee and only twenty minutes from St. George Island and Apalachicola, this retreat can be tailored to your own adventurous spirit.
